Team Dover’s 1 charlies are a cut above the rest

The 436th Operation Support Squadron’s 1C0X2 team poses for a group photo at Dover Air Force Base, Delaware, Jan. 18, 2024. The team recently won the Air Mobility Command Sgt. Dee Campbell Aviation Resource Management Large Unit Team of the Year Award. The team showcased direct operational support of the unit mission by initiating crews for the strategic airlift of two MQ-8C unmanned helicopters, facilitating the deployment of an airborne mine detection prototype across 50 partner nations during the second-largest naval exercise. The team also generated 732 flight authorizations, verified 15,000 flight and ground requirements, facilitated 473 combat sorties and 1,300 flight hours supporting Operation Spartan Shield, which transported over 32 million pounds of cargo and 1,200 passengers.
